Danella's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Divide Danella's SSA record in two at 1979 and the more recent half accounts for 53%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 47%, a genuinely balanced usage pattern. Its calmest year was 1916,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 2011 peak of 27,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Danella?
Danella has been given to 870 babies in the U.S. since 1914, according to SSA data. Its archive ordinal is #8,264 of 72,339 among girls' names (total births, highest first). Among girls in 2025, it is #10,167 of 17,297. 27 babies were born in 2011, its single highest year.
Where does Danella sit in the SSA name archive?
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Danella ranks #8,264 of 72,339 girls' names by all-time recorded births (highest first) and #10,167 of 17,297 among girls' names in 2025. All-time ordinal matches browse popularity (total births DESC); the current ordinal uses the 2025 SSA file. See /methodology#corpus-placement.
When was Danella most popular?
Danella was most popular in the 1970s decade with 126 total births. The single peak year was 2011.
Where is Danella most popular?
The top states for the name Danella are Texas (11 births), New York (6 births).
How long has the name Danella been used?
The SSA has tracked Danella since 1914 -- 112 years through the most recent 2025 data.
